capot
Definitions
noun
A winning of all the tricks in the game of piquet, counting for forty points.
There are three chances in this game, viz., the repique, pique, and capot[…]The Capot is , when either of the Players make every Trick , for which he is to count forty ; instead of which he counts but ten , when he only gets the Majority of the Tricks, which is called , the Cards
A curious score was made in a game of piquet with one of the ladies. [...] In the fifth hand she made a piquet and capot, scoring 121 to 0, and in the sixth hand, being the minor, she made a repiquet, taking all but the last trick, counting 111 to 3, totalling 270, and rubiconing her opponent at 99, with a win of 469 points.
verb
To win all the tricks (from), when playing at piquet.
